§ 43-38-808. Failure to Take Action

If the cooperative does not effectuate the proposed action that gave rise to the dissenter’s rights within two (2) months after the date set for demanding payment, the cooperative must send a new dissenter’s notice under § 43-38-804 and repeat the payment demand procedure if it effectuates the proposed action.

§ 43-38-702. Complaint

A complaint in a proceeding brought in the name of a cooperative must allege with particularity the demand made, if any, to obtain action by the board of directors or officers, and either that the demand was refused or ignored, or why the member did not make a demand.

§ 43-38-703. Court Approval Needed to Discontinue or Settle a Proceeding

A proceeding commenced under this part may not be discontinued or settled without the court’s approval. § 43-38-704. Expenses

On termination of the proceeding the court may require the plaintiff to pay the defendant’s reasonable expenses, including counsel fees, incurred in defending the proceeding, if it finds that the proceeding was commenced without reasonable cause.
